KUWAIT CITY, Jun 18: Kuwait's Foreign Minister, Sheikh Jarrah Al-Jaber, held a telephone conversation on Thursday with Iranian Foreign Minister Dr. Abbas Araqchi, during which he expressed Kuwait’s hope that the recently signed memorandum of understanding between the United States and Iran would contribute to strengthening stability across the region.
According to a statement, Sheikh Jarrah said Kuwait hopes the agreement will help safeguard security and freedom of navigation in the Strait of Hormuz while paving the way for sustainable solutions to outstanding regional issues through dialogue and diplomacy.
The Kuwaiti foreign minister emphasized that relations between states should be governed by the principles of international law and the objectives enshrined in the United Nations Charter. He stressed the importance of adhering to the principles of good neighborliness, respecting the sovereignty, independence, and territorial integrity of all countries, and refraining from interference in their internal affairs.
Sheikh Jarrah also underscored the need to avoid the use or threat of force, calling for disputes and conflicts to be resolved through peaceful means. He further highlighted the importance of ending support for proxy groups, saying such measures would help reinforce regional security and stability and serve the common interests of the countries and peoples of the region.
The call comes amid heightened regional attention on the US-Iran memorandum of understanding and its potential impact on Gulf security, maritime navigation, and broader efforts to reduce tensions in the Middle East.
